How Does an Amplifier Affect Subwoofer Performance?

An amplifier plays a crucial role in enhancing subwoofer performance by providing the necessary power and control for optimal sound output.

  • Power Output: The power output of an amplifier directly influences the volume and dynamics of the subwoofer. A high-quality amplifier delivers sufficient wattage to prevent distortion at high volumes, allowing the subwoofer to reproduce deep bass frequencies accurately without compromising sound quality.
  • Impedance Matching: Proper impedance matching between the amplifier and subwoofer is essential for efficient power transfer and performance. An amplifier that matches the subwoofer’s impedance ensures that it operates within its optimal range, enhancing the overall sound and preventing overheating or damage to the equipment.
  • Signal Processing: Many modern amplifiers come with built-in signal processing features such as crossover controls and EQ settings. These allow users to tailor the sound output to suit specific preferences or vehicle acoustics, ensuring that the subwoofer delivers the best possible bass response.
  • Dynamic Range: A good amplifier enhances the dynamic range of the subwoofer, allowing it to produce both soft and loud sounds with clarity. This results in a more immersive listening experience, where the subtleties of music can be heard, and the impact of bass notes can be felt powerfully.
  • Thermal Management: High-quality amplifiers often include thermal management features to prevent overheating during extended use. This ensures consistent performance and longevity of both the amplifier and the subwoofer, maintaining sound quality over time.

What Features Should You Consider When Choosing a Car Audio Subwoofer Amplifier?

When selecting the best car audio subwoofer amplifier, several key features should be considered to ensure optimal performance and compatibility.

  • Power Output: The power output, measured in watts, determines how effectively the amplifier can drive the subwoofer. A higher RMS (Root Mean Square) wattage rating typically means the amp can provide cleaner and more powerful sound, allowing for better bass response.
  • Impedance Matching: It’s crucial to match the amplifier’s impedance rating with that of the subwoofer. Most car audio subwoofers have impedance ratings of 2, 4, or 8 ohms, and using an amplifier that can handle the correct impedance ensures maximum power transfer and sound quality.
  • Number of Channels: Amplifiers come in various channel configurations, such as mono, 2-channel, or multi-channel. For subwoofers, a mono amplifier is often recommended as it is designed to efficiently power a single subwoofer or multiple subs wired together.
  • Built-in Features: Many amplifiers come with built-in features such as crossover settings, bass boost, and remote gain control. These features can enhance the sound quality and allow for fine-tuning of the bass response to suit personal preferences or the acoustics of the vehicle.
  • Cooling System: An effective cooling system, whether through heat sinks or built-in fans, is essential for maintaining performance and preventing thermal damage. Amplifiers can generate significant heat during operation, so adequate cooling helps to ensure longevity and reliability.
  • Size and Installation Flexibility: The physical size of the amplifier can impact where and how it can be installed in your vehicle. Compact designs can fit into tighter spaces, while larger amplifiers may require more room but potentially offer higher power output.
  • Build Quality and Durability: A well-constructed amplifier from durable materials can withstand the rigors of car environments, such as temperature fluctuations and vibrations. Look for models with solid enclosures and quality components to ensure longevity and consistent performance.

What Common Pitfalls Should You Avoid When Selecting a Car Audio Subwoofer Amplifier?

When selecting the best car audio subwoofer amplifier, it’s essential to avoid common pitfalls that can lead to suboptimal performance.

  • Mismatch of Power Ratings: It’s critical to ensure that the amplifier’s power output matches the subwoofer’s power handling capability. Using an underpowered amplifier can result in poor sound quality and distortion, while an overpowered amplifier can damage the subwoofer.
  • Ignoring Impedance Compatibility: Subwoofers come with different impedance ratings (usually 2, 4, or 8 ohms), and the amplifier must be compatible. Using an amplifier that doesn’t match the subwoofer’s impedance can lead to inefficient performance and even overheating.
  • Overlooking the Quality of Components: The build quality of the amplifier’s components, such as capacitors and transistors, can significantly affect durability and sound quality. Cheaper amplifiers may save money upfront but can lead to long-term issues and poor audio performance.
  • Neglecting Cooling Requirements: Amplifiers generate heat during operation, and if they lack adequate cooling features, they can overheat and fail. It’s important to choose an amplifier with good heat dissipation mechanisms, especially for high-power applications.
  • Failing to Consider System Compatibility: The amplifier should be compatible with the overall sound system, including the head unit and other speakers. An incompatible system can result in mismatched sound levels or insufficient power delivery throughout the audio setup.
  • Not Evaluating Space Constraints: Car audio setups often have limited space, and the size of the amplifier should be considered. Selecting a unit that doesn’t fit well within your vehicle can lead to installation challenges and may affect overall system performance.
